To enhance engraving quality by synthesizing a desired cutting toolpath from image data corresponding to an image to be engraved, thereby obtaining large flexibility.
An image processing computer 40 connected to an engraving controller 38 generates digital image data regarding an image to be engraved by an engraving unit 10 and the engraved image. And, a digital signal processor or processing means 42 connected to the controller 38 generates a toolpath to be traced by a cutter stylus 30 so as to engrave an engraving area to be engraved in response to a flow of the digital image data. Further, an amplifier 53 connected to the processor or the means 42 amplifies a signal generated from the processor or the means 42, transmits it to an engraving head 28, and drives the stylus 30 so as to engrave a pattern on the engraving area of a surface of a cylinder 24. Thus, engraving quality can be enhanced.
